Relationship between Presence of Third Molars and Prevalence of Periodontal Pathology of Adjacent Second Molars: a Systematic Review and Meta-analysis.

出版信息

Chin J Dent Res. 2022 Mar 16;25(1):45-55. doi: 10.3290/j.cjdr.b2752683.

Abstract

OBJECTIVE

To estimate the mean prevalence of periodontal pathology of adjacent second molars (A-M2s) to third molars (M3s) and identify related confounding factors.

METHODS

Studies published before August 2020 were systematically searched in the Cochrane Library, EMBASE and MEDLINE databases. We included cross-sectional studies that evaluated the periodontal pathology of A-M2s based on clinical or radiographic examinations at the molar level. Studies employing similar periodontal parameters were pooled. Clinical attachment loss ≥ 3 mm, alveolar bone loss ≥ 3 mm or ≥ 20% root length were defined as early periodontal defects, and at least one site with probing depth ≥ 5 mm was considered as deep periodontal pockets around A-M2s in the data synthesis.

RESULTS

Nine studies (14,749 M3s) were ultimately included in the meta-analysis. On average, 19% of A-M2s showed distal early periodontal defects with the presence of M3s (95% confidence interval [95% CI] 9%-35%). Subgroup analyses suggested the prevalence was 32% (95% CI 16%-54%) in the mandible, and the prevalence was higher with nonimpacted M3s (25%, 95% CI 12%-47%) than with impacted M3s (19%, 95% CI 10%-35%). Additionally, the pooled prevalence for deep periodontal pockets around A-M2s was 52% (95% CI 39%-64%). Subgroup analyses suggested the prevalence was higher in the mandible (62%, 95% CI 45%-76%) than in the maxilla (43%, 95% CI 31%-56%), and for nonimpacted M3s the prevalence reached 50% (95% CI 36%-64%).

CONCLUSION

The presence of M3s, especially mandibular and nonimpacted M3s, negatively affects the periodontal status of A-M2s.

摘要

目的

评估第三磨牙(M3)近中第二磨牙(A-M2)牙周病的平均患病率,并确定相关的混杂因素。

方法

系统检索 Cochrane 图书馆、EMBASE 和 MEDLINE 数据库中 2020 年 8 月之前发表的研究。我们纳入了评估 M 水平临床或影像学检查中 A-M2 牙周病的横断面研究。对采用相似牙周参数的研究进行了汇总。临床附着丧失≥3mm、牙槽骨丧失≥3mm 或≥20%根长定义为早期牙周缺损,至少一个位点探诊深度≥5mm 被认为是 A-M2 周围深牙周袋,用于数据综合。

结果

最终纳入 9 项研究(14749 个 M3)进行 meta 分析。平均而言,19%的 A-M2 有 M3 时表现出远中早期牙周缺损(95%置信区间[95%CI]9%-35%)。亚组分析表明,下颌骨的患病率为 32%(95%CI 16%-54%),而非阻生 M3 的患病率(25%,95%CI 12%-47%)高于阻生 M3(19%,95%CI 10%-35%)。此外,A-M2 周围深牙周袋的总患病率为 52%(95%CI 39%-64%)。亚组分析表明,下颌骨的患病率较高(62%,95%CI 45%-76%),上颌骨的患病率较低(43%,95%CI 31%-56%),而非阻生 M3 的患病率达到 50%(95%CI 36%-64%)。

结论

M3 的存在,特别是下颌骨和非阻生 M3 的存在,会对 A-M2 的牙周状况产生负面影响。
